Responsibilities

As a Peer Recovery Specialist, your role is diverse and critical. You'll actively engage in linking individuals to recovery communities and ancillary services, encouraging sobriety-based activities, and providing ongoing support throughout their recovery journey. Advocacy on behalf of individuals with families, courts, and service systems is crucial, ensuring access, responsiveness, and protection of personal rights. Your contributions in coordinating services, completing necessary documentation, and promoting positive interactions within Chestnut and the broader community are fundamental.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Five years in recovery or a combination of experience and education totaling 5 years
  • Crisis Intervention Training (CIT) or preference for crisis intervention training
  • Valid driver’s license, private automobile insurance, and insurability
  • Basic computer skills: MS Word, email, and electronic medical record (EMR) usage
